VMware Tanzu Kubernetes Grid Integrated Edition (TKGI) 1.19.1 - 運營商 Kubernetes 解決方案

sysin發表於2024-07-23

VMware Tanzu Kubernetes Grid Integrated Edition (TKGI) 1.19.1 - 運營商 Kubernetes 解決方案

Kubernetes-based container solution with advanced networking, a private container registry, and life cycle management

請訪問原文連結:https://sysin.org/blog/vmware-tkgi/,檢視最新版。原創作品,轉載請保留出處。

作者主頁:sysin.org


VMware Tanzu Kubernetes Grid Integrated Edition (TKGI) 使運營商能夠使用 BOSH 和 Ops Manager 配置、運營和管理企業級 Kubernetes 叢集。

VMware Tanzu Kubernetes Grid Integrated Edition(以前稱為 VMware Enterprise PKS)是基於 Kubernetes 的容器解決方案,具有高階網路、私有容器登錄檔和生命週期管理功能。

概述

Tanzu Kubernetes Grid Integrated Edition 將 Kubernetes 部署到 BOSHOps Manager,並使用 On-Demand Broker動態地在本地或公共雲上例項化、部署和管理高度可用的 Kubernetes 叢集。

運營商安裝TKGI後,開發人員可以使用 TKGI 命令列介面 (TKGI CLI) 來配置 Kubernetes 叢集 (sysin),並使用 Kubernetes CLI 在叢集上執行基於容器的工作負載 kubectl

操作員將 TKGI 作為磁貼安裝在 Ops Manager 安裝儀表板上,或從 vSphere 上的 TKGI 管理控制檯。

您可以獨立執行 TKGI 或與適用於 VM 的 VMware Tanzu 應用程式服務一起執行在運維管理器上。

架構概覽

Tanzu Kubernetes Grid Integrated Edition 環境包含一個 TKGI 控制平面以及一個或多個工作負載叢集。

Tanzu Kubernetes Grid Integrated Edition 管理員使用 TKGI Control Plane 部署和管理 Kubernetes 叢集。工作負載叢集執行開發人員推送的應用程式。

下面舉例說明 Tanzu Kubernetes Grid 整合版元件之間的互動:

HA TKGI Control Plane with HA TKGI API VM Group and HA DB VM cluster

管理員訪問 TKGI 控制平面 透過安裝在其本地工作站上的 TKGI 命令列介面 (TKGI CLI)。

在 TKGI 控制平面內,TKGI API 和 TKGI Broker 使用 BOSH 來執行請求的叢集管理功能 (sysin)。有關 TKGI 控制平面的資訊,請參閱下面的 TKGI 控制平面概述。有關安裝 TKGI CLI 的說明,請參閱 安裝 TKGI CLI

Kubernetes 在 Kubernetes 叢集上部署和管理工作負載。管理員使用 Kubernetes CLI,kubectl, 指導 Kubernetes 從他們的本地工作站。有關資訊 kubectl,請參閱 概述Kubernetes 文件中的 kubectl。

詳見

TKGI 為 Kubernetes 新增了什麼

下表詳細介紹了 Tanzu Kubernetes Grid Integrated Edition 為 Kubernetes 平臺新增的功能。

特徵 包含在 K8s 中 包含在 Tanzu Kubernetes Grid 整合版中
單租戶入口
安全的多租戶入口
有狀態的 Pod 集
多容器吊艙
對 Pod 的滾動升級
滾動升級叢集基礎設施
Pod 擴充套件和高可用性
叢集配置和擴充套件
叢集虛擬機器和程序的監控和恢復
永久性磁碟
安全的容器登錄檔
嵌入式、加固的作業系統

原英文描述:

Feature Included in K8s Included in Tanzu Kubernetes Grid Integrated Edition
Single tenant ingress
Secure multi-tenant ingress
Stateful sets of pods
Multi-container pods
Rolling upgrades to pods
Rolling upgrades to cluster infrastructure
Pod scaling and high availability
Cluster provisioning and scaling
Monitoring and recovery of cluster VMs and processes
Persistent disks
Secure container registry
Embedded, hardened operating system

特徵

Tanzu Kubernetes Grid 整合版具有以下特點:

  • Kubernetes 相容性 :與 Kubernetes 的當前穩定版本持續相容
  • 生產就緒 :從應用程式到基礎設施高度可用,沒有單點故障
  • BOSH 優勢 :內建健康檢查、擴充套件、自動修復和滾動升級
  • 全自動操作 :全自動部署、擴充套件、打補丁和升級體驗
  • 多雲 :跨多個雲的一致操作體驗

先決條件

關於安裝Tanzu Kubernetes Grid Integrated Edition的資源需求資訊,請參見您的雲提供商對應的主題:

  • vSphere 先決條件和資源要求
  • vSphere with NSX-T 版本要求Tanzu Kubernetes Grid Integrated Edition on vSphere with NSX-T 的硬體要求
  • GCP 先決條件和資源要求
  • AWS 先決條件和資源要求
  • Azure 先決條件和資源要求

下載地址

VMware Tanzu Kubernetes Grid Integrated Edition (TKGI) 1.19
百度網盤連結:[EoD]

  • Tanzu Kubernetes Grid Integrated Edition Management Console 1.19.0
    File size: 13.77 GB
    Name: tkgi-v1.19.0-rev.1-7792e0f1-23604053.ova
    Release Date: 2024-04-09
    SHA256SUM: bf27e025467f398066340810432285a7e965333512fea26c16dc0ca42c9c9737

VMware Tanzu Kubernetes Grid Integrated Edition (TKGI) 1.19.1
解決方案元件:

1. TKG Integrated Edition
百度網盤連結:https://sysin.org/blog/vmware-tkgi/

  • Tanzu Kubernetes Grid Integrated Edition Management Console 1.19.1
    Name: tkgi-v1.19.1-rev.1-f92b6e6a-24029820.ova
    File size: 12.96 GB
    Last Updated: Jun 17, 2024 08.52PM
    SHA256SUM: a74b4f863813b3698f7095fc1ef64bbf5203f1e7151535f3a52ceb377a872c7c

2. Advanced Container Networking and Security

  • VMware NSX 4 - 網路安全虛擬化平臺

3. Workload Backup and Recovery:

  • Velero 1.12.1
    百度網盤連結:https://sysin.org/blog/vmware-tkgi/

相關產品:VMware Tanzu Kubernetes Grid (TKG) 2.5.1 - 企業級 Kubernetes 解決方案

更多:VMware 產品下載彙總

相關文章